Recommended setup workflow
A strong MikroTik router uae implementation starts with a structured workflow. First, confirm your internet handoff details (PPPoE, DHCP, static IP, or bridge mode) and gather device inventory, including switches, access points, and cabling quality. Next, design the addressing plan, VLAN strategy (if you use segmented networks), and naming conventions so maintenance stays simple. Then configure core services: stable WAN settings, correct DNS behavior, MikroTik router uae secure management access (using strong authentication and restricted admin interfaces), and a hardened firewall baseline. After that, enable traffic management such as queue-based bandwidth limits, prioritize business-critical traffic, and verify that latency-sensitive applications work as expected. Finally, validate with connectivity tests, failover checks (if applicable), and a review of logs to catch issues early.
Security and performance best practices
For enterprise-minded networks, security should be treated as a first-class requirement, not an afterthought. Experts recommend disabling unnecessary management exposure, using firewall address lists and service filtering, and applying safe defaults that reduce attack surface. If you need remote access, use secure methods such as VPN with properly scoped permissions rather than opening router services to the internet. Performance also depends on tuning: set appropriate Wi-Fi channel width and placement, choose bands based on coverage needs, and align transmit power with site constraints to reduce interference. For multi-user deployments, traffic shaping prevents bandwidth spikes from impacting VoIP, gaming, or video calls. Monitoring should be enabled through relevant alerts and log review so anomalies are detected quickly instead of during customer complaints.
